[vc_row][vc_column][vc_single_image image=”17752″ img_size=”900×500″ alignment=”center”][vc_column_text]When Netflix decided to adapt the New York Times bestselling novel There’s Someone in your House, by Stephanie Perkins into a film, they wanted a Director who was well versed doing the kind of film they wanted to produce. They have made their choice as Patrick Brice, the director behind Creep, The Overnight, and Corporate Animals, has been chosen to take the helm.
Henry Gayden, the screenwriter for Shazam! penned the adaptation, and it is being produced by Shawn Levy’s 21 Laps and James Wan’s (Aquaman) Atomic Monster.
Production for the film which is reported to be a combination of the popular slasher films of the 80’s and 90’s and the coming of age films popularized by directors like John Hughes. Think Jason meets 16 Candles. On second thought, don’t think that…it’s too scary to contemplate. Production is slated to begin in the fall.
